Let S be the set of all quadratic equations of the form x^2+b x+c=0 , where b, c 1,2,3 , 4,5,6 . If an equation is selected at random from S , then the probability that the equation has real roots is
Options
- A9 12
- B9 36
- C19 36
- D7 36
Correct answer
C. 19 36
Step-by-step solution
Given S= x^2+b x+c=0 . ; b, c 1,2,3,4,5,6 Since, we know that a quadratic equation a x^2+b x+c=0 has real roots, if b^2-4 a c 0 a=1 , hence condition for the given equation is b^2-4 c 0 Total number of equations in S , which has roots aligned & =6 6 n(S) & =36 aligned Let E be the event, which contains equations having real roots following condition b^2 4 C array ll & n(E)=19 & P(E)= n(E) n(S) = 19 36 array
